About

Ziping Cao is a scholar working on Organic Chemistry, Materials Chemistry and Inorganic Chemistry. According to data from OpenAlex, Ziping Cao has authored 62 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 45 papers in Organic Chemistry, 12 papers in Materials Chemistry and 11 papers in Inorganic Chemistry. Recurrent topics in Ziping Cao's work include Catalytic C–H Functionalization Methods (18 papers), Catalytic Alkyne Reactions (18 papers) and Synthetic Organic Chemistry Methods (12 papers). Ziping Cao is often cited by papers focused on Catalytic C–H Functionalization Methods (18 papers), Catalytic Alkyne Reactions (18 papers) and Synthetic Organic Chemistry Methods (12 papers). Ziping Cao collaborates with scholars based in China, France and United States. Ziping Cao's co-authors include Haifeng Du, Jinmao You, Guang Chen, Zhaoqun Liu, Xuejun Sun, Xin Meng, Fabien Gagosz, Yuxia Liu, Lingxin Chen and Ming Nie and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and Biomaterials.
